Marcuse & Remmel partnership and the story of a neighborhood.

Marcuse and Remmel were both of German provenance. Felix Marcuse came from Berlin in the 1870s and started his own business on Lincoln Ave. It was a general store with a wide customer base. In the late 1880s there was a real estate boom and as properties in the area became available for development, he saw it as a great business opportunity and partnered with Remmel, who at the time was a piano teacher. As building partners they became the most successful building firm in the Alameda's history; they built at least 350 houses in the city, and the Bay Station neighborhood holds the largest concentration.
